Usman Tariq, PE, CEM, PMP, LEED AP BD+C, has relocated to the LA architecture studio from HDR’s Washington, D.C. office, where he was most recently the associate managing principal. Serving in that role for the past three years, he was responsible for project delivery, operations and P&L for one of the largest studios in the firm. Having played an instrumental role in HDR’s successful growth in D.C, he is looking forward to being part of a renewed sense of identity for the firm in its new downtown Los Angeles office.
“The move from Pasadena is a catalyst for a storied future for HDR that is driven by excellence in design, quality and innovation, while remaining focused on client and community engagement,” he said.
